Executive summary

The Talent Acquisition Partner plays a crucial role in our HR team and organization as the owner of the end-to-end recruitment process, including attraction, selection, and retention. The TA Partner invests significant time and effort in building the right organizational capabilities and identifying optimal solutions to attract potential candidates.

The responsibilities include sourcing candidates through various channels, planning interview and selection procedures, creating the right candidate’s experience, and ensuring compliance with the attraction, selection, and hiring processes as well as being engaged in the Talent Acquisition & Talent Development strategies development and execution, co-leading Talent & HR initiatives, projects, and processes aligned with the defined priorities & objectives.

As a TA Partner, you will work closely with business leaders, external partners, and networks, you will establish mid and long-term partnerships with Talent across various levels, co-design the Talent & HR strategies, and contribute to the employer branding initiatives.
